Solution for 5(n-2)-(7-6n)=10n equation:


Simplifying
5(n + -2) + -1(7 + -6n) = 10n

Reorder the terms:
5(-2 + n) + -1(7 + -6n) = 10n
(-2 * 5 + n * 5) + -1(7 + -6n) = 10n
(-10 + 5n) + -1(7 + -6n) = 10n
-10 + 5n + (7 * -1 + -6n * -1) = 10n
-10 + 5n + (-7 + 6n) = 10n

Reorder the terms:
-10 + -7 + 5n + 6n = 10n

Combine like terms: -10 + -7 = -17
-17 + 5n + 6n = 10n

Combine like terms: 5n + 6n = 11n
-17 + 11n = 10n

Solving
-17 + 11n = 10n

Solving for variable 'n'.

Move all terms containing n to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-10n' to each side of the equation.
-17 + 11n + -10n = 10n + -10n

Combine like terms: 11n + -10n = 1n
-17 + 1n = 10n + -10n

Combine like terms: 10n + -10n = 0
-17 + 1n = 0

Add '17' to each side of the equation.
-17 + 17 + 1n = 0 + 17

Combine like terms: -17 + 17 = 0
0 + 1n = 0 + 17
1n = 0 + 17

Combine like terms: 0 + 17 = 17
1n = 17

Divide each side by '1'.
n = 17

Simplifying
n = 17
